This was case with me before I had mine week before Xmas and this was a no go in my book. Rang up insurance company and now mine is due every Feb instead.
Grand. Once i know its doable without penalty (as in affect future insurance) ill visit it again around March.
Yeah can be done no bother. You've 2 options: Wait until the renewal and ring your insurance company and ask them how much it is to renew to X date as you want to change the time of year its due & pay whatever it is. 

If they wont do that then you can renew it for 12 months and cancel it during the year and take a policy out elsewhere. You'll get hit with a cancellation fee which can vary in price so check that out beforehand.
